St Ali North

Contemporary$$

Can a cup of coffee taste like papaya and lime, or mandarin marmalade perhaps? Team St Ali says it can, and they search far afield (as in halfway round the world) for special brews. The third-wave coffee thing, plus the rad bike path out the front door, give this cafe a distinct Melbourne zeitgeist flavour, but the food occasionally misses the target. A jerk chicken thigh burger with house-made hot sauce is a fiery winner, but chorizo and chive scrambled eggs with bite-size octopus chunks may fall flat. Plump potato gnocchi with chilli-broccoli puree and grilled asparagus is a safer bet. There are lovely little cakes and pastries in the display cabinet, too.
